![]() | The Past Tense (2005) (The fifth book in the Diagnosis Murder series) A novel by Lee Goldberg |
| "With a devilish plot sense, sophisticated humor, and smooth writing style, Lee Goldberg's Diagnosis Murder books never fail to please." Donald Bain |
Dr. Mark Sloan is startled to discover a dead woman--dressed as a mermaid--washed up on the beach outside his home. Even more bizarre, the autopsy reveals a digital memory card within a capsule inside the body's stomach. The card contains the report of a forty-three-year-old murder in Los Angeles--the first homicide case Mark ever solved, when he was a struggling intern and newlywed father.
When a second body is discovered--a woman who was apparently the victim of an impromptu autopsy in her own kitchen--the good doctor realizes that he must find the connection between the two murders. And perhaps more urgently, the connection to his own past...
